Nathan Alan Braddy, 8, of Calhoun died on Sunday, April 16, 2017 from injuries received in an accident. He was born in Gordon County on July 17, 2008. Nathan was a student in the second grade at Fairmount Elementary School. Nathan was preceded in death by his great-grandfathers, Charles Greeson, J.C. Langford, and Rev. James Braddy. He will be remembered as a bright and loving young man who could light up a room with his mischievous smile.
Nathan is survived by his mom, Sayrah Greeson; his grandparents, Danny Greeson, Laura Worley, Randy and Lori McElrath, and Mitzi and Ricky Reed; his sister, Madison Johnson; his great-grandparents, Donald and Faye Worley, Peggy Greeson, and Evelyn Braddy; his aunts and uncles, Kala Greeson, Julee Greeson, Holly Hennessee, Keith and Charmon VanDyke, Matthew Rice, and Tammy and David Manly; many other relatives and friends.
